Game Notes For Monday @ KC

* The White Sox have won eight of 11 meetings with the Royals this season and the teams have seven games left against each other. Despite the success against Kansas City, Chicago has been outscored 49-46 in those contests. * With a walkoff homer in the ninth inning yesterday, Jim Thome became the third player to reach the 500 career home run plateau this season, the others being Frank Thomas and Alex Rodriguez. * Six of Paul Konerko’s ten hits against the Royals this season have gone for extra bases (five homers and a double). * The White Sox have hit 172 homers this season. They need 28 in 13 games to reach 200 for the eighth consecutive season. * The Royals are tied with the Twins for the worst mark in the AL this month (4-10). * Emil Brown is batting .400 (24-60) in his last 17 games, including hitting safely in 15 of his last 16 starts. * The Royals are hitting just .236 (33-140) with runners in scoring position this month, lowest in the majors
